Transaction 67b68790c840dba83c824f0fe7219a52d822c4c8a76a2cb8379105e073e8f3e0
1 Input
1 Output
-
67b68790c840dba83c824f0fe7219a52d822c4c8a76a2cb8379105e073e8f3e0:0
- value
- 5832684
- script pubkey
- OP_0 OP_PUSHBYTES_20 34770aacdc26716abb4a8045e07aef3c06a349e1
- address
- bc1qx3ms4txuyeck4w62spz7q7h08sr2xj0p2ahz3a